Custom Deer Mounts

When you want a custom deer mount, the first thing your taxidermist will do is take detailed measurements in order to select the correct sized holder to fit your deer’s skin. You will also want to decide on the direction that you want your deer’s head turned.

Deer Mount Ideas

Once the head position has be decided upon, the next step is to choose a pose for your deer taxidermy.

You have the option to choose from upright, semi-upright, semi-sneak, and pedestal, the most commonly chose out of these is the upright position.

Remember, if you choose an upright or semi-upright pose, make sure there is enough room on top for the antlers to clear the ceiling.

Once you’ve chosen the pose and the turn of your deer, you need to decide how you’d like to display it in your home. You can hang it on the wall in a traditional flat back manner, or you can go a step further, and have your taxidermist attach it to a wooden display panel to compliment the décor in your home.

Deer Mount Ideas to Choose From

As you know, different forms will make a mount look very unique. Each one has their own emotion and presence. As an example, let’s look at the various whitetail deer mount styles to see how you might explain to a customer how to choose a taxidermy mount.   • Upright: This mount features a deer that is standing tall and alert. The classic deer mount, it is a proud position normally mounted with alert ears and a slight turn to the left or right to accentuate the antlers. It is important to note that this pose needs to be hung lower on the wall but it does not stick out too far.
  • Semi-Upright: The semi-upright mount pose is less alert than the full upright mount, as the neck is lowered slightly. It offers a more natural look for a relaxed, dominant buck mount. Rotating one ear forward and one backward can also be a nice detail for a relaxed deer.
  • Semi Sneak: Is a relaxed pose that can be created with a small or large head turn. This position allows for the ears to be mounted either alert, relaxed, or one of each. This pose allows for the mount to be higher on the wall, but note that it does stick out farther than the upright mount.
  • Full Sneak: This is the most relaxed pose and can have ears that alert or relaxed. Not as popular as the Upright and Semi Sneak but a good change up from the typical poses.  It can be hung the highest on the wall but also extends the farthest from the wall.
  • Sweep Sneak: It shows a stretched-out, muscular rut neck with deep shoulders. The parallel neck position keeps the antlers lower for better ceiling clearance, though the deer also extends out into the room more. It resembles a buck in pursuit of a doe, so a curling lip or open mouth is a good artistic touch.
  • Pedestal: There are two different types of pedestal mounts that make great whitetail shoulder mounts. The floor pedestal mount brings it down to your level to save wall space and is very realistic looking, especially if you add other natural touches. The wall pedestal mounts show the deer’s front shoulder as if they are standing more or less broadside, which is a refreshing option to add to any trophy room.

Deer Skull Ideas

Some taxidermy enthusiasts prefer to show off their whitetail buck in the form of a skull. Think you want a deer skull instead of a shoulder mount or pedestal? Here are some deer skull ideas below:

1.) Deer Skull/European Mount

For the standard deer skull/European mount, all you need to do is bring your deer to your local taxidermist and have them prepare your deer skull for you. Once finished, simply hang on the wall in your living room, den, family room, or cabin. Read here for more information on how to hang a European mount.

2.) Deer Skull Stand

For a more natural deer skull idea, you can try a deer skull stand. Not only can you enjoy the beauty of a white deer skull, but you can also add habitat along with it – wooden log, stones, fake leaves, and fake grass or moss to complement it. Going with a deer skull stand is a great choice if you prefer your skull to sit on a desk and not be hung on your wall.

Deer Skull Ideas

3.) Vertebrae Skull Mount

For a more unique mount display, you can try a deer skull mount along with some of the vertebrae from the buck. Alternatively, you can purchase artificial vertebrae. A vertebrae mount with the deer skull will make a great addition to your taxidermy or skull collection!

4.) Pedestal Mount

Another deer skull idea you can choose is the pedestal mount. If you are a more crafty person, you can make a DIY wooden pedestal or chat with your taxidermist to see if they have one for you to display your deer skull on. This is a more unique approach to the standard deer skull display.

5.) Multiple Deer Skull Wall Mount

If you have shot several deer, you can design a multiple deer skull wall mount. You can place one in the middle and two above and below it. Choosing a multiple skull design is a great choice for any hunter or cabin owner – plus it shows off the majesty of these whitetail antlers!
